Output 06597c63c76e033b298216592d195c24d7f519775087d25b2484e31ff53591d6:1

value
5330706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 371b04c409e8ad8daa79c608a22d09f2787f6ef4 OP_EQUAL
address
36iPTP3GBiMSgafjdu8PmXHJWzQVeRxuoN
transaction
06597c63c76e033b298216592d195c24d7f519775087d25b2484e31ff53591d6
spent
true